Texas Investment Firm Acquires Ownership Interest in EnergySource
IMPERIAL VALLEY, CA -- OCTOBER 19, 2016 - Mills Capital Group, LLC, a closely held private investment firm based in Texas, acquired a 38 percent ownership interest in EnergySource, LLC through the formation of LiNERGY, LLC. Injection of CO2 Started at ON Power’s Geothermal Plant in Nesjavellir, Iceland
Carbfix’s new pilot CCS plant at ON Power’s geothermal plant at Nesjavellir, Iceland is now operational and injection of CO2 and H2S has started at the site. This is a result of significant research and development carried out within the EU Horizon2020 project GECO to further improve the Carbfix technology. Ormat successfully completed the Ngatamariki Geothermal Plant
Ormat Technologies, Inc. (NYSE: ORA) announced today that it has successfully completed the 100 MW installed capacity Ngatamariki geothermal power plant in New Zealand under the $142 million Supply and Engineering, Procurement and Construction (EPC) contracts signed with Mighty River Power (MRP) in June 2011.
